Model 410 firmware 6600 cvs red problems in Windows I have a red CVS model 410 with firmware 6600. I installed libus-wind32 version 1.12 and finally got that to work with ops21 for use with the CVS camcorders. However, I can't this 410 to work with this version of libusb. I would imagine I'm doing something stupid (like that hasn't happened before?? :) ). I have pv2tool version 2.19, and it doesn't have an executable for libusb version 1.12. In addition, I downloaded a copy of the .inf file from this forum, then added the stuff up to pid 30. When I plug the camera in, Windows wants the driver so I point it to that .inf file. Then it says the following 3 files weren't found:
- libusbfl.sys
- libusbis.exe
- libusbst.sys
Additionally, I have run a search for each of these files and they aren't anywhere on my PC.
Surely I have missed something, but what? :)
I wanted to do this because I want to try the how-to for unlocking it via the shorting of 2 pins method. The way I read that how-to, it indicates the camera must be found first, and it won't be found until the driver is loaded.

Thanks, ZAC. I removed version.12 via add/remove programs, then ran the filter install for version .10. When it first started it said it couldn't find libusb0.dll, so I found it in the version .10 bin folder and copied it to the Windows folder. I also saw a libusb0.sys in the same folder so I copied it to Windows/system32.
OPS21 starts, but it can't find the model 230 or model 200 video cameras. I haven't tried again to "fix" the model 410 digital camera since I also have to have Ops21 working for the camcorders as well.
Any ideas? :)
EDIT: Yes, I was running ops21 for libusb .10. Aslo, I just tried the model 410 digital camera again and it still cannot find the 3 files mentioned above.
EDIT: SUCCESS!!!! I had a bad copy of libusb0.dll in one of the system folders. Replaced it with the one from the libusb version .10 bin directory.
Both camcorders work fine!! AND -- the digital camera works!!! I used the legal pin shorting method from the how-to's and was able to have the camera download raw images, delete images and take a picture!!
